Episode 17: Liz Allan and Sam Clarke - Entrepreneurship, Legacy EV infrastructure equipment and making change happen
Liz Allan speaks to Sam Clarke who is the Chief Vehicle Officer at Gridserve, the previous CEO of Gnewt which is a fully electric delivery fleet, and the Finance Director of the EV Café. They talk about how entrepreneurship brought him to where he is now, his concerns regarding the Legacy equipment still being used in the EV infrastructure, and what he would love the sector to look like in the future.
